How do I apply for a handicap placard in California?
To apply for a handicap placard in California, you need to complete Form Ref 195, which is available on the California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) website. After filling out the form, gather the required documents, including medical verification and proof of identification. Submit your application by mail or in person at a DMV office. Following the approval process, your handicap placard will arrive in the mail.

What disabilities qualify for a handicap placard in California?
Disabilities that qualify for a handicap placard in California encompass a wide range of conditions. Conditions like heart disease, lung disease, and severe mobility limitations apply. To apply, you need to understand Form Ref 195, as it outlines the criteria and documentation necessary to establish your eligibility.
